ON Semiconductor FOD3125SD High-Speed Gate Drive Optocoupler
The FOD3125SD is a state-of-the-art high-speed gate drive optocoupler designed by ON Semiconductor, a leading provider of semiconductor-based solutions. This device is specifically engineered to meet the stringent requirements of driving power IGBTs and MOSFETs in a variety of applications. The FOD3125SD provides electrical isolation between the input signal and the output gate drive, ensuring that high-voltage transients on the power switch do not affect the low voltage control electronics.
Featuring a high peak output current of 2.5A, the FOD3125SD is capable of driving large capacitive loads with ease, making it ideal for use in motor control, industrial inverters, and switching power supplies. Its fast propagation delays and minimal pulse-width distortion enhance the overall efficiency and performance of the system by ensuring precise timing control.
The optocoupler integrates a GaAlAs LED optically coupled to an integrated circuit with a power output stage. This robust design provides a high Common-Mode Rejection (CMR) of 35kV/µs minimum at VCM = 1500V, which is critical for protecting against the effects of high-speed switching and ensuring stable operation in noisy environments.
The FOD3125SD operates within a wide supply voltage range of 15V to 30V, accommodating various gate drive voltages for different power semiconductor switches. It also features under-voltage lock-out protection (UVLO) with hysteresis, which prevents the power switch from operating at insufficient gate voltages that could otherwise lead to inefficient switching or damage.
For enhanced reliability, the FOD3125SD is housed in a compact, surface-mount 8-pin DIP package with 400 mil spacing (SDIP-8). The package is designed to optimize insulation and minimize package capacitance, providing excellent isolation capabilities while maintaining a small footprint on the PCB.
